Babelube vs. Liquid Silk
I keep Babelube and Liquid Silk in the cyber-dyke studio’s safe sex supplies box and offer both types to models. I also dip into the box sometimes for personal use, but don’t tell the boss lady. I like both lubes and I use both depending on which one jumps into my hands.

Babelube is your basic no frills plain all purpose lube. It’s water-based and glycerin-free. Several of us have used it for anal sex in addition to pussy play, and it works well for both. It works well for masturbation and I’ve used it on my play partners. It does leave a bit of the usual lube stickiness, but most lubes do. It’s not the wettest lube I’ve used, so if you like it extra slick this might not be your first choice. It is long lasting and very affordable. It’s a clear color, gel texture, unscented and tastes like lube. I wouldn’t recommend tasting it. It’s really affordable and much better than other lubes in the price range. The largest size bottle comes with a pump for easier access.

Liquid Silk has a long history in our studio. I can’t remember who first brought it over. It might have been Zille or Ondine. I can’t remember all the details, but the two of them were doing a scene together and one squirted a glob of the lube into the other’s hands. This lube is white and about the same consistency as natural body fluids, so the receiver was a bit shocked to have a handful of white body fluids squirted all over, if you know what I mean. This is a very good lube, creamy and white with no scent of flavor. It is water based, glycerin-free and it cleans up really well. It keeps things really wet. It’s also antibacterial so you don’t have to worry about accidentally sharing germs with your partners. It does come in a pump bottle, so it’s easier to stay safe and clean. This lube works for toys, and anal sex in addition to all your favorite types of pussy play. It tastes bitter so you probably won’t want to use it for oral sex.
